Transaction 29ae083090338a36e30c81ec663e6137b6a1587521bad50c943f4fb50e61efac
1 Input
1 Output
-
29ae083090338a36e30c81ec663e6137b6a1587521bad50c943f4fb50e61efac:0
- value
- 39647968
- script pubkey
- OP_0 OP_PUSHBYTES_20 261b7c716ec8c892abcaeabbcdcd4fd6c6fb1c59
- address
- bc1qycdhcutweryf9272a2aumn206mr0k8zef3en99